Product Description:

The MS2E04-C0BTN-CSSG0-NNNBN-NN is a three-phase permanent-magnet servomotor from Bosch Rexroth Indramat that belongs to the MS2E Synchronous Servomotors series. Under digital drive control, it produces synchronous torque for controlled motion in industrial machinery. Designed for closed-loop position and velocity tasks, the motor integrates into drive axes where quick acceleration and accurate feedback are required for packaging, assembly, or pick-and-place stations.

During operation, the motor reaches a nominal speed of 6000 rpm, supporting high cycle rates in fast-moving axes. Position feedback is delivered by the Advanced Performance ACUROlink single-turn encoder, which has a functional resolution of 20 bits and measures absolute position within one revolution. A single rotatable M23 cable connection carries power and data, reducing the amount of wiring required between the motor and drive. For installation, the housing uses a B5 / IM3001 mounting pattern with an 82 mm flange, a 50 mm centering collar, a 95 mm bolt circle, and 6.6 mm mounting holes. The IP65 enclosure protects internal components against dust and water jets when the motor is installed correctly.

The motor operates in ambient temperatures from 0 to 40 °C without derating, while its self-cooling design transfers heat through the varnished RAL 9005 housing. A smooth shaft with a shaft sealing ring transfers torque to a compatible coupling and helps prevent contaminants from reaching the internal bearings. Deep-groove ball bearings support the rotor, while a PT1000 sensor monitors winding temperature during operation. The motor is supplied without a holding brake, so an external mechanism or drive-generated torque must secure static loads. Fast response is supported by the low-inertia rotor, which reduces the effort required for acceleration and deceleration. The size 04 frame and length code C provide a compact housing while maintaining suitable power density for automated motion axes. Standard flange accuracy supports precise alignment, and the motor can be installed at altitudes up to 1,000 m under its stated operating conditions.
